A balloon dilatation catheter defines a side aperture defined in the catheter shaft between the ends of the catheter and communicating between the guidewire lumen and the catheter exterior. A removable support mandrin may occupy a proximal lumen of the catheter. The mandrin may define a distal tip portion which is positioned preferably closely proximal to the aperture. The distal tip portion may have a reduced diameter relative to the average diameter of portions of the mandrin which are proximal to the tip portion, for providing mandrin tip flexibility. Also, a catheter-stiffening bridge member may be positioned within and permanently secured to the catheter adjacent to the aperture portion, to reduce catheter kinking adjacent thereto. |
